Aulette, Judy Root was born on November 26, 1948 in Detroit, Michigan, United States. Daughter of George Clifford and Catherine Ruth Root.
Bachelor, Wayne State University, Detroit, 1970; Master of Arts, Wayne State University, Detroit, 1976; Doctor of Philosophy, Michigan State University, East Lansing, 1986.
Lecturer, Michigan State University, 1976-1981; lecturer, Ohio State University, Lima, 1981-1984; instructor women's studies and sociology, U. Arizona, Tucson, 1984-1986; assistant professor sociology, U. North Carolina, Charlotte, 1986-1994; associate professor, U. North Carolina, Charlotte, since 1994. Adjunct Professor women's studies U. North Carolina, Charlotte.

Member American Sociological Association (county sexual and gender section 1987), Society for Study Social Problems (chairman labor studies division 1986-1989, chair family division since 1994), Sociologists for Women in Society (vice president 1992-1994), North Carolina Sociological Association (county 1990-1993), Association for Humanist Society (editor journal 1988-1991).
Married Albert Aulette, April 4, 1970. Children: Anna Ruth, Elizabeth Rose.
